It would be the second day of the Comfort Inn Winter Classic, and start with the consolation game between the #10 Wilkes Colonels and the Wentworth Leopards from the Ronald B Stafford Ice Arena. The Leopards would get the game's opening goal at the 7:55 mark of the first period from Ian Worthley to give them the 1-0 lead. The CColonelswould come back and tie the game at 1the 2:12 mark of the period on the rebound goal from Christian Blomquist, and that's where the first period would end. The game would stay there until the 5:18 mark of the third period when the Leopards would take the lead on the snip from George Kolovos for the 2-1 lead. Then, with the goalie pulled in the closing minutes of regulation, the Colonles would tie the game up on the Miles Harrington score with 1:38 left. The teams would head to overtime, where George Kolovos would get the game-winner on the rebound to complete the upset victory. Jack McGovern would make 48 saves on the afternoon in the winning effort for the Leopards, as they would go to 5-8-2 on the season and upset the #10 Wilkes Colonels. As for the Colones, they would fall to 9-5 on the season as Duncan Rolleman would make 25 saves in the loss.
